NSCDC Officer Shot Dead In Abuja Hotel

A personnel of the Nigeria Security and Civil Defence Corps (NSCDC), DSP Adama Adekunle Emmanuel, has allegedly been shot dead by a colleague under unclear circumstances in the Life Camp area of Abuja.

Naijabrain reports that on Sunday, August 31, a police officer died while on assignment at a hotel. According to Daily Trust, the officer’s widow, Titilayo Adams, suspects foul play, claiming his injuries were inconsistent with an accident.

“From his body, we can visibly see gunshots at his shoulders, and nothing strong indicating that it’s accidental fire. They want to cover up what actually occurred,” she claimed.

She added that the body was taken to Maitama General Hospital without the family’s consent.

According to Adams, her husband had been attached to a politician in the Life Camp area and left home on Sunday morning with plans to return later that day.

“He left the house on Sunday (August 31st) and was supposed to have returned home yesterday Sunday,” she explained.

The family, however, was only informed of his death later that afternoon by a colleague, identified simply as Emmanuel.

“It’s after Sunday service that his colleague, Mr. Emmanuel, came to inform us that he mistakenly shot himself multiple times which led to his death. And we learnt that Emmanuel himself wasn’t at the spot where it happened. He was called and informed about the incident,” she said.

The widow expressed frustration at what she described as three conflicting reports surrounding the officer’s death.

“We are told, first, that it was accidental discharge while fixing his rifle. Second, that it was friendly fire and his colleague accidentally shot him. Third, that he shot in the air and the bullet bounced back on him,” she noted.

Adams lamented the silence of NSCDC authorities, saying the family had received no official briefing on the incident.

“They said they are coming to see us but to this moment nobody contacted us to brief us about the mysterious incident that led to the untimely death of my husband,” she said.

She appealed for justice and support, highlighting the family’s hardship following his death.

“My husband left behind his parents, two children who resumed school today, and our house rent also expired. They should also take care of his burial rites. I have no job to cater for the children — all I want is justice for my husband,” she pleaded.

When contacted on the development, the FCT Police Command PRO, Josephine Adeh, told journalists that “I will call for confirmation and details then get back to you please.”

However, she has not issued any further statement regarding the development as of the time of filing this report, Naijabrain reports.
